Michigan summers are the best, and we understand the importance of making the most of those few months of beautiful weather! And guess what?! Research shows that outdoor exercise provides greather benefits than exercising indoors. From increased energy to decreased stress, staying active outside opens the door to positive feelings and endless opportunities! 
Exercising outdoors can burn more calories, elevate your self-esteem, vary your work out,  save you money, allow you to disconnect, and give you a greater sense of well-being! 
Aside from the benefits of sweating outdoors, it's important to keep in mind safety in warm weather, such as exercising at the right time, staying hydrated, dressing accordingly, and listening to your body (and your doctor). Learn ways to stay active in the summer heat
It's okay to ditch the gym for a little while, especially since West Michigan is full of outdoor adventures (and May is also National Bike Month). From biking and walking routes on campus and local parks to beaches and hiking trails, there is something for everyone!
